SRM Functionality for New created Company Code

Former Member
0 Kudos

Hi everybody,

Client is already using SRM 4.0 , a new Company Code is created with all R/3 settings & now wants to start SRM functionality for this new CCode.Initially to start with Business scenarios will be Self Service procurement + Catalog (Requisite)with Technical Scenario "Classic"

Can you provide me stepwise settings or points to be consider for the same?

Hi Pravin,

As you say you want to use catalogs for creation of SC you need to do all related settings

for CCM

i.e. customizing for CAT & CSE

integrated call structure for yr catalogs

SICF settings

and creation of supplier , master catalog , mapping , publishing etc.

With this catalog items will be available for SC.

Now other settings:

1. Since you are working in classic scenario you don't actually replicate

company codes, pur org, but give ref of the same at respective level in yr SRM org

structure i.e. for the respective units in 'function' tab you will mention the r/3 co cd

and pur org nos and input the SID of backend.

2. Vendors you can import with trans BBPGETVD from backend

3. Users you can first create in SRM SU01 (or distribute from CUA) then assign with trx USERS_GEN

to yr SRM org structure (after this only they can log in SRM)

4. Pur grp again you should mention the R/3 nos in the function tab and assign the org

unit at 'responcibility'tab in org structure.

5. Matl grp- this is downloading (trx R3AS) of customizing object DNL_CUST_PROD1 after you have done

all integration settings, SMOEAC sites and middleware setting as per note 720819

6. for creation of org structure i am sending you a word file

7. Roles you can find in the resp config guide

8. it's downloading of matl& services in SAP terminology if you are importing R/3 matls

in SRM , uploading is reverse, trx R3AS after customizing objects have been downloaded

9. catalog - already mentioned

Pravin

Regarding Requisite there is not much config required as you are just adding new company codes.

Check if any new vendors are to be brought to the existing catalogs. Then find if users want to view catalog items based on each vendor.

If that is the case then create views in Requisite system for each vendor and assign those views to the catalog user(created in requisite).

Then create a new Web service in SRM to access that catalog and give the User and Password dedails same as created in the above step.

Finally assign the required calaog ID(Web service) in the respected user attributes.

Regarding catalog load process in Requisite, there is no change. Just load the new vendor catalog in the same format what they are maintaining now. Prerequisite is that vendor should be replicated to SRM from R/3.
